summaryrefslogtreecommitdiffstats
path: root/libxrdp/libxrdp.c
diff options
context:
space:
mode:
authorspeidy <speidy@gmail.com>2014-03-04 10:19:19 +0200
committerspeidy <speidy@gmail.com>2014-03-04 10:19:19 +0200
commit43f4d439ec52616ccf6380374e21bce0b7087694 (patch)
treea1318234fd983d16265b77c8cafda13c4486b177 /libxrdp/libxrdp.c
parent1f1e803140ea96b81ac4700a6759a9617d0f2fd2 (diff)
downloadxrdp-proprietary-43f4d439ec52616ccf6380374e21bce0b7087694.tar.gz
xrdp-proprietary-43f4d439ec52616ccf6380374e21bce0b7087694.zip
libxrdp: work on fastpath, length issue
Diffstat (limited to 'libxrdp/libxrdp.c')
-rw-r--r--libxrdp/libxrdp.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/libxrdp/libxrdp.c b/libxrdp/libxrdp.c
index ae2690f2..dc7a9869 100644
--- a/libxrdp/libxrdp.c
+++ b/libxrdp/libxrdp.c
@@ -29,6 +29,7 @@ libxrdp_init(tbus id, struct trans *trans)
session = (struct xrdp_session *)g_malloc(sizeof(struct xrdp_session), 1);
session->id = id;
+ session->trans = trans;
session->rdp = xrdp_rdp_create(session, trans);
session->orders = xrdp_orders_create(session, (struct xrdp_rdp *)session->rdp);
session->client_info = &(((struct xrdp_rdp *)session->rdp)->client_info);